2016-09-24 3 views
0

Windows 10 (64 비트)에서 glmnet 비 네트를 MATLAB R2016a에 사용하려고합니다. 나는 here에서 버전을 다운로드했다. 때마다 함수 (예 : cvglmnet)를 사용하려고하면 MATLAB이 충돌합니다.MATLAB에서 glmnet 사용하기 R2016a

MATLAB 용 glmnet 버전은 MATLAB 2013b (64 비트)에서만 테스트되었지만 다른 버전의 MATLAB에서이를 사용할 수 있었는지 및 그 방법을 알고 싶었습니다. 나는 문제가 MATLAB 충돌에 오류가

This error was detected while a MEX-file was running. If the MEX-file 
is not an official MathWorks function, please examine its source code 
for errors. Please consult the External Interfaces Guide for information 
on debugging MEX-files. 

를 말합니다하지만 난 그렇게하는 방법을 알고하지 않기 때문에 어쩌면 다시 컴파일해야 MEX 파일입니다 생각합니다.

답변

1

포트란 파일을 다시 컴파일하는 문제가 해결되었습니다. 이렇게하려면 Visual Studio 2015를 설치 한 다음 Fortran 용 Intel Parallel Studio XE 2016 (2017 버전이 작동하지 않음)을 사용하고 MATLAB 터미널에 다음을 사용했습니다.

관련 문제